Directory System Agent
DSA

(DSA) The software that provides the X.500 Directory Service
for a portion of the directory information base. Generally,
each DSA is responsible for the directory information for a
single organisation or organisational unit.

Cobaea \Co*bae"a\, Cobaea \Co*b[ae]"a\(k[-o]*b[=e]"[.a]), prop.
n. [Named after D. Cobo, a Spanish botanist.]
A genus of climbing plants, native of Mexico and South
America. Cobaea scandens (called cup-and-saucer vine,
monastery bells, or Mexican ivy) is a conservatory
climber with large bell-shaped flowers.

Electronic Discrete Sequential Automatic Computer
EDSAC

(EDSAC, often "Electronic Delay Storage
Automatic Computer") Based upon the EDVAC (Electronic
Discrete Variable Automatic Computer) designed in 1945, the
EDSAC was completed in 1949 at the University of Cambridge
Mathematical Laboratory in England. The EDSAC performed its
first calculation on 1949-05-06. EDSAC was considered to be
the first computer to store programs. It ceased to exist in
about 1951.

HANDSALE, contracts. Anciently, among all the northern nations, shaking of
hands was held necessary to bind a bargain; a custom still retained in
verbal contracts; a sale thus made was called handsale, venditio per mutuam
manum complexionem. In process of time the same word was used to signify the
price or earnest which was given immediately after the shaking of hands, or
instead thereof. In some parts of the country it is usual to speak of hand
money as the part of the consideration paid or to be paid at the execution
of a contract of sale. 2 Bl. Com. 448. Heineccius, de Antique Jure
Germanico, lib. 2, Sec. 335; Toull. Dr. Civ. Fr. liv. 3, t. 3, c. 2, n. 33.
